Original filePersian depiction of Jesus - Sermon on the Mount
A Persian miniature painting featuring Jesus sitting cross-legged at the right, identified by a golden, flame-like halo and a white turban. He is dressed in a red robe and faces a semi-circle of seated male followers in patterned tunics and turbans, who look toward him with varied expressions of attention. To the lower right, a woman in a patterned dress holds a small infant, while a tree stands on the hill behind the group against a blue sky. The figures are rendered in a flat, stylized manner with saturated colors including deep blues, reds, and yellows, set against a pinkish-brown, stylized landscape.
This painting reflects the syncretic tradition of Persian Islamic art, where 'Isa (Jesus) is venerated as a major prophet. Such depictions highlight the intersection of Christian narrative traditions within an Islamic iconographic framework, often appearing in historical manuscripts regarding the lives of the prophets (Qisas al-Anbiya).
